- Stability: Earlier versions had infamous camera clipping issues during cutscenes. V1.05a smooths out the 3D environments significantly. The rice paddies and shrine steps finally look like places, not polygons.
- New "Twilight" Events: The patch adds four new evening events that weren't in the base 1.0 release. These aren't fan service (well, mostly not). They are quiet scenes—watching fireworks from a distance, sharing a sweat-glistening popsicle, realizing her suitcase is already half-packed in the closet.
- The Epilogue Shift: Without spoilers, the original ending was abrupt. V1.05a adds a 10-minute epilogue set one year later. It recontextualizes the entire "lesson" from a romance into a story about grief and letting go.
